Euro steadies versus dollar after July eurozone inflation beat
EUR/USD traded near 1.1600 as eurozone annual HICP rose to 2.9% and traders pared odds of a Fed rate hike to 32.8% for September.
EUR/USD rose during European hours on Wednesday, holding around 1.1600 after minor losses the prior day, as the euro found support from July eurozone inflation data.
Eurozone annual HICP increased to 2.9% from 2.8% in June, matching preliminary estimates and staying above the ECB’s 2.0% target. Core inflation, excluding food and energy, also edged up to 2.5% from 2.4%, reinforcing a more hawkish ECB tone amid concerns about elevated energy costs and continued upside risks from food inflation.
The currency pair also gained as the US dollar weakened on fading expectations for a Fed rate hike next month, with US retail sales falling in July for the first time in nine months. According to the CME FedWatch tool, traders priced only a 32.8% chance of a September hike, down from 51.2% a month earlier, and attention turned to the release of the Fed’s July meeting minutes for fresh direction.
